Abstract
Motivations and constraints regarding the identification of DT-fueled, 1,000-MWe-class commercial power-plant embodiments of the (low-aspect-ratio) spherical tokamak (ST) are summarized in the context of ongoing ARIES studies. Key design drivers are identified and the prospects of this approach to magnetic fusion energy are considered
